The Athletic is a renowned digital sports media company dedicated to connecting passionate sports enthusiasts with the athletes, teams, and leagues that capture their interest. Since its inception in 2016, The Athletic has established itself as a pivotal platform for sports fans craving a deeper connection and understanding through immersive storytelling. With operational hubs in major cities like San Francisco, Los Angeles, London, and Melbourne, the organization boasts a diverse global team of over 600 creators. Covering more than 250 professional and collegiate sports teams across the United States, Canada, and the UK, The Athletic is committed to delivering comprehensive sports coverage. It has produced thousands of in-depth reports, over 120 podcasts, and various premium content formats, establishing itself as a central figure in the universe of sports enthusiasts.
